Scheidegg is a city in the westallgäu near the Austrian border. The mountains of the Bregenz Forest with the 1062 m high Pfänder and the high Alps are wonderful to see, but also the mountains of the Swiss Säntis.

background

Scheidegg is a Kneipp health resort and climatic health resort and, with 3,200 guest beds, is one of the 10 most important tourist locations in the Swabian region. Due to the low fog altitude, Scheidegg has over 2,000 hours of sunshine annually and in 2007 it was “Germany's sunniest place”. The community Scheidegg consists of the places Scheidegg, Scheffau and Lindenau as well as several hamlets and farms.

The place is on the border to Vorarlberg. The neighboring towns Sigmarszell, Opfenbach, Lindenberg and Hamlet-Simmerberg belong to the district of Lindau, Möppers, Langen near Bregenz and Sulzberg lie in Vorarlberg.

getting there

By train and bus

The nearest train station is Roethenbach on the route Lindau - Immenstadt - Munich.
A little further lies Hergatz, from where also the regional trains via Wangen in the Allgäu to Aulendorf or Memmingen drive.

Buses run at least every hour via Lindenberg to Röthenbach and Hergatz.

Tourist Attractions

  • 1 Scheidegger waterfalls with the water world adventure park in the Rickenbach valley
entry: 1.50 €, children 5-13 years: 1.- €. Outside the opening times, the waterfalls are accessible at your own risk. ·
Directions: The Scheidegger waterfalls are on a side road in the area of ​​the B 308 about 2 km northwest of Scheidegg. Hikers can find the waterfalls via Bräuhausstraße and the marked hiking trail to Rickenbach (parking lot).
  • 2 Hasenreuter waterfalls - 1800 m above the Scheidegger waterfalls, the Rickenbach forms the Hasenreuter waterfalls in the south. In the past, water power was also used here.
How to get there: From the center of Scheidegg, take the state road 2378 in the direction of Möggers (A). 475 m after the place-name sign there is a hidden sign on the right side of the road in the forest "Hasenreuter waterfalls".
